摘要
In this letter, a feasible three-dimensional ultra-broadband carpet cloak is presented. To realize the structure, use of multilayer dielectrics are proposed. The results prove that the three-dimensional conducting bump can be concealed from all the viewing angles in an ultra-broadband frequency range of 8-30 GHz. An experimental results confirm the performance of the proposed pyramidal cloak in practice. (C) 2017 Wiley Periodicals, Inc.
